Pizotifen is a medication used to prevent migraines and is often subject to impurities. These impurities can be unwanted byproducts of the manufacturing process, or they can be degradation products that form over time. These impurities can impact the efficacy and safety of the drug and must be monitored and controlled to ensure its quality. Identification and quantification of Pizotifen impurities are important for regulatory compliance and quality control purposes.
